Maximizing Rewards with the Alliance Bank Visa Infinite
If you're anything like me, you do most of your spending online and through e-wallets. The Alliance Bank Visa Infinite card is perfect for this, as it offers an amazing 8x Timeless Bonus Points (TBP) for every Ringgit spent on online purchases and e-wallet top-ups (up to RM3,000 per statement cycle). Its about spend RM1.88 = 1 Enrich Point.
Here's how I made the most of it:
1.Everyday Spending: I put all my online shopping, bill payments, and e-wallet top-ups on my Visa Infinite. This quickly racked up a ton of TBP.
2.Choosing a Partner: The Alliance Bank lets you transfer TBP to various partners, including Malaysia Airlines Enrich. Enrich lately offers great redemption rates for flights.
3.Transferring Points: Transferring TBP to Enrich was super easy just through the Alliance Bank online banking platform or call to customer service centre.
4.Booking My Dream Flight: With my Enrich points, I booked a round-trip business class ticket to Auckland. The points covered most of the cost, leaving me with a tiny out-of-pocket expense for taxes and fees.
Key Takeaways for Fellow Alliance Bank Visa Infinite Users
Maximize Your Points: Take full advantage of the 8x TBP on online and e-wallet spending to accumulate points quickly. It’s one of the fastest credit card to accumulate enrich mile in Malaysia market. Visa Infinite/ Platinum its about spending RM1.88 = 1 Enrich airmiles
Plan Ahead: Start saving points early to have enough for your desired flight.
Be Flexible: Chase the deal. Consider traveling during off-peak periods for better redemption rates and availability, it required lesser enrich miles.

Frequently asked questions (FAQ )
How many Enrich Points does it cost to fly from KL to London? At the time of writing, mas was having a 20% off , it takes 52,000 Points in Economy or 170,000 Points in Business Class to return from Kuala Lumpur to London for Enrich saver.
How do I check my Enrich Points? Login to your Enrich account on the Malaysia Airlines website to check your current points balance.
How long do Enrich Points last? Malaysia Airlines Enrich Points typically expire three years after the month they are earned but Alliance bank points are timeless points.
What is Enrich membership? Enrich is the frequent flyer program of Malaysia Airlines. Holding Enrich membership enables you to earn and redeem Enrich Points on flights, as well as earn Enrich status if you’re a frequent traveller. It’s also allow you to book hotel thru enrich points or redeem with one world member airlines.
